Output 8f86452554c7468940f43f315cec84f16ee6e5113a540df3a09618f0c49eb672:0

value
590386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1271d73cc784cb4b5101833409e7c590718dff08 OP_EQUAL
address
33NYTnu3gHQUtAPn2sG8gb4A9wAe1DuGf8
transaction
8f86452554c7468940f43f315cec84f16ee6e5113a540df3a09618f0c49eb672
spent
true